There is also the very popular and established The Teaching Assistant Program in France for those aged 20-35 that offers a stipend of € 790 (net/month), but it fills up quickly, so apply well ahead. Web10 months in France. Up to three awards are offered to students enrolled in a doctoral program in the United States to pursue research for their thesis at Université Paris-Saclay. Candidates may carry out research projects in any of the disciplines represented at Université Paris-Saclay.

WebThe Franco-American Fulbright Commission was established in 1948 to foster leadership, learning, and empathy between the United States and France.
